Produktbeschreibung
Jackie Taylor's love for writing is something she has enjoyed most of her life and is a shared family passion for the matriarchs in her family. Jackie Taylor has been published in the Long Island Entertainment Magazine (Interview Michael Feinstein, Staller Center) also The Long Island Sounds Anthology 2007/2015 and various articles for local Magazines. "I don't let a day go by without writing, it is another part of my artwork in linear form and always available to me," says Jackie. Jackie currently has a completed Anthology being reviewed acclaimed poets Cornelius Eady, Jericho Brown and Kimiko Hahn and several books in the works. Jackie is a stylist for over twenty-five years during which time she has furthered her artistic education by obtaining a Bachelor of The Arts and is currently pursuing a Masters in Humanities with an Art Concentration. Jackie is a hair designer whose artistic approach is the foundation for her career and believes in continual education Jackie strives to stay at the forefront of her field by doing so creating beautiful hairstyles for photo shoots, theater, commercials, weddings, premiers, key social events and is employed at the Eastern end of Long Island.
Autorenporträt
Jackie Taylor is originally from London but has lived and worked in rural Cornwall for the past 20 years. She has several jobs and writes when she can, mainly short stories and poetry. Her short stories have appeared in various publications, most recently in Mslexia and the Stories For Homes 2 anthology.
